Repointing in Cleveland, OH
Repointing services involve renewing the mortar joints between bricks or stones on a building's exterior. This process is essential for maintaining the structural integrity and appearance of masonry surfaces, especially on older or weathered properties. Common projects include restoring brick walls, chimneys, foundations, and decorative stonework. Homeowners typically seek repointing when they notice crumbling mortar, gaps, or deterioration that could lead to water infiltration or further damage over time.
Before requesting repointing services, property owners should assess the condition of their masonry and consider the scope of work needed. It’s helpful to understand the type of mortar originally used, as matching the existing material is important for a seamless repair. Additionally, knowing the extent of damage or deterioration can guide decisions on whether repointing alone is sufficient or if other repairs are necessary. Proper preparation and expert evaluation ensure the longevity and stability of the masonry work.

Repointing Questions
What is repointing on a property? Repointing involves renewing the mortar joints between bricks or stones to improve stability and appearance.
When should repointing be considered? Repointing is recommended when mortar shows signs of cracking, erosion, or weather damage.
What types of projects typically require repointing? Repointing is common for historic buildings, brick walls, chimneys, and exterior facades needing restoration.
How does repointing benefit a property? Repointing helps prevent water infiltration, maintains structural integrity, and enhances curb appeal.
